At that time he didn’t think he should, and now I think he realizes, so that’s a good step,” Ford’s lawyer Dennis Morris told the Toronto Star. “He’s doing what I think most of the population thought would be appropriate a number of months ago. The unverified recording is the latest such incident in the mayor’s infamous record of being belligerent and spouting off in a drunken and/or drug-fueled stupor. Notorious crack-smoking Toronto Mayor Rob Ford is taking a break from the campaign trail to address issues pertaining to substance abuse, according to an announcement made by his attorney on Wednesday.įord’s admission comes after an alleged audio recording (warning: offensive language) of him at local bar surfaced earlier this week, where he can reportedly be heard being “unruly” and making offensive comments about mayoral contender Karen Stintz.
